So glad we signed up for this tour. While in town for a conference, hubs and I wanted to experience the music scene but were unsure where to go. This tour gave us a good variety, while also explaining other venues we might consider with our limited time. Jaqs (our guide) and Kelty (the driver) did a great job keeping us all engaged and explaining not only the venue, but history and facts of the neighborhoods we visited. Our first stop was The Continental, where we listened to Rock (I'd consider it Alternative rock), which took me back to my 20's. Then we traveled across town to The Sahara for Afrobeats. I never would have looked for a venue like this, but it was our favorite spot! Finally, we ended at C-Boys for some Americana/Country. Although my husband and my music taste differs (I enjoyed all three venues) it was still a fun time at each spot.
